As the weekend draws to a close, it’s natural to want to extend well-wishes to friends, family, colleagues, or anyone else in your life. While the sentiment remains the same, there are countless ways to express the hope that someone had an enjoyable weekend.

From simple phrases to more elaborate expressions, each conveys a sense of care and positivity.

In this article, we’ll explore 35 alternative ways to say “I hope you had a great weekend,” offering a diverse range of options to suit various relationships and situations.

List of Other Ways to Say “I Hope You Had a Great Weekend”

  • I trust your weekend was enjoyable.
  • I hope your weekend was fantastic.
  • Wishing you had a wonderful weekend.
  • Hoping your weekend was filled with joy.
  • Trusting your weekend brought happiness.
  • I hope your weekend was delightful.
  • I trust your weekend was pleasant.
  • Hoping your weekend was fabulous.
  • I hope your weekend was lovely.
  • Wishing you had an amazing weekend.
  • I trust your weekend was relaxing.
  • I hope your weekend was rejuvenating.
  • Wishing you had a fantastic weekend.
  • I hope your weekend was refreshing.
  • Trusting your weekend was fulfilling.
  • I hope your weekend was restful.
  • Wishing you had a great time over the weekend.
  • I trust your weekend was peaceful.
  • Hoping your weekend was filled with fun.
  • I hope your weekend was memorable.
  • Trusting your weekend was enjoyable.
  • I hope your weekend was satisfying.
  • Wishing you had a fantastic time off.
  • Hoping your weekend was fulfilling.
  • I hope your weekend was rejuvenating.
  • Wishing you had a relaxing weekend.
  • Trusting your weekend was splendid.
  • I hope your weekend was enjoyable and productive.
  • Wishing you had a wonderful time over the weekend.
  • I hope your weekend was filled with laughter.
  • Trusting your weekend was enriching.
  • I hope your weekend was blissful.
  • Wishing you had a fantastic break.
  • Hoping your weekend was full of happiness.
  • I trust your weekend was everything you needed.
